コックスサッキーウイルスA24感染は,急性軟体性麻痺の形を示します
Lancet (London, England)
|September 18, 2001
まとめ
コックスサッキーウイルスA24は,発症の可能性が高いウイルスで,急性軟体性麻痺 (AFP) の発症と関連付けられています. この発見は,野生のポリオウイルスの感染を模倣するので重要なものです.

背景:
- エントロウイルスは,急性軟体性麻痺 (AFP) の発症を引き起こすことが知られている.
- 野生のポリオウイルス感染症は,世界的にAFPの流行の主要な懸念事項です.
- コックスサッキーウイルスA24は発生可能性が高いが,以前はAFPと関連付けられていなかった.
研究 の 目的:
- 東ティモールにおけるコクサッキーウイルスA24とAFPの関連性を説明する.
- AFPの文脈でコクサッキーウイルスA24の発生の可能性を強調する.
主な方法:
- 東ティモールにおけるAFP患者の症例説明.
- コックスサッキーウイルスA24を病原体として特定した.
主要な成果:
- コックスサッキーウイルスA24は,AFPの流行と関連していました.
- このウイルスは,以前はAFPに関与していなかったが,有意なアウトブレイクの可能性を示した.
結論:
- コックスサッキーウイルスA24は,AFPの発生の差異診断に考慮されるべきです.
- コックスサッキーウイルスA24のような非ポリオ腸ウイルスに対する監視は,公衆衛生にとって極めて重要です.

Viral Meningitis
Viral meningitis is the most common form of meningitis and is often referred to as aseptic meningitis to indicate the absence of bacterial involvement. It is generally milder than bacterial meningitis, with symptoms including fever, headache, stiff neck, drowsiness, nausea, photophobia, and vomiting. Arboviral Encephalitis
Arboviral encephalitis refers to brain inflammation caused by arthropod-borne viruses, particularly those transmitted through mosquito vectors. Among these, West Nile virus (WNV), a member of the Flaviviridae family, is a significant public health concern. WNV is an enveloped, positive-sense, single-stranded RNA virus. Amebiasis
Entamoeba histolytica, a protozoan parasite, is responsible for intestinal and extraintestinal amebiasis. Though a significant proportion of infections remain asymptomatic, approximately 50 million individuals annually are estimated to present with clinical disease, resulting in up to 100,000 deaths globally. Encephalitis l: Introduction
Encephalitis is inflammation of the brain parenchyma, most often due to infections or autoimmune processes. It presents with neuropsychiatric features such as fever, altered mental status, behavioral changes, cognitive dysfunction, seizures, focal deficits, and sometimes autonomic instability.
